With a Tampa boat rental, must-see destinations include Davis Islands and Harbour Island for calm cruising and scenic views of downtown Tampa. For beach lovers, Caladesi Island State Park and Egmont Key offer pristine, boat-access-only shorelines perfect for swimming, shelling, and snorkeling. Beer Can Island is a lively party spot popular on weekends, while Apollo Beach provides a quieter escape and a chance to see manatees nearby. Whether you’re after relaxation or vibrant social scenes, Tampa’s waters offer diverse boating options.

Sandbar Hopping & Island Days

One of the most popular things to do in Tampa is anchoring at local sandbars and islands. Beer Can Island and Egmont Key offer shallow water, laid-back vibes, and plenty of space to swim and relax.

Sunset Cruises & Dolphin Spotting

Tampa’s west-facing coastline makes it ideal for sunset boating. Cruise near St. Pete Beach or along the barrier islands for golden-hour views, calm waters, and frequent dolphin sightings.
